How do you think the autonomic nervous system works with other body systems?
r-ruslan [8.4K]

Explanation:

The autonomic nervous system regulates certain body processes, such as blood pressure and the rate of breathing. This system works automatically (autonomously), without a person's conscious effort. Disorders of the autonomic nervous system can affect any body part or process.
